When cooling a patient with possible heat stroke, which one of the following would be of most concern to the EMT?
 
  A) Blood pressure increasing to 102/78 mmHg
  B) The heart rate going from 140 beats to 120 beats per minute
  C) Observing your partner apply a sheet soaked in tepid water to the patient
  D) Determining that the patient is shivering after having cold packs applied to the neck

Looking at the sun may not only cause headache and distort your vision temporarily, but it can also cause permanent eye damage. Any exposure to sunlight adds to the cumulative effects of ultraviolet (UV) radiation on your eyes. UV exposure has been linked to eye disorders such as macular degeneration, solar retinitis, and corneal dystrophies.

The liver is the only organ that has the ability to regenerate itself after certain types of damage. As much as 25% of the liver can be removed, and it will still regenerate back to its original shape and size. However, the liver cannot regenerate after severe damage caused by alcohol.
